Abigail Adams Birthplace
Welcome to the Abigail Adams Birthplace, a cherished historical landmark located at 180 Norton Street, Weymouth, Massachusetts. Built in 1685, this remarkable home was where Abigail Smith Adams, one of America's most influential women, spent the first twenty years of her life. Despite enduring two relocations, the birthplace stands proudly today as a tribute to her extraordinary legacy. South Weymouth Naval Air Station South Field
Welcome to South Weymouth Naval Air Station South Field, a historic site located at 10 Patriot Parkway, Weymouth, Massachusetts. Established in 1942, this renowned air station served as a pivotal United States Navy blimp base during World War II and later transitioned into a hub for Naval Air Reserve Training. Throughout its operational years, the station supported a variety of Navy and Marine Corps reserve aircraft squadrons, playing a crucial role in both wartime and peacetime operations. During World War II, NAS South Weymouth was instrumental in anti-submarine blimp operations, hosting airship patrol squadron ZP-11 and supporting convoy escort missions. The site was also the starting point for the first transatlantic crossings of non-rigid airships, marking a significant milestone in aviation history.

South Byfield Cemetery
Welcome to South Byfield Cemetery, a serene and intimate resting place located at 53-55 Warren Street, Georgetown, Massachusetts. Founded in 1856, this historic cemetery offers a peaceful environment for loved ones to pay their respects and is cherished by the local community for its quiet beauty and deep-rooted history. Nestled within 14 acres of picturesque landscape on the North Shore, South Byfield Cemetery is a private sanctuary dedicated to serving the families of Byfield, Georgetown, and nearby areas. This unique cemetery is "for the community, run by the community," ensuring a responsive and caring atmosphere for all who visit.
